
This editable lesson focuses on the core Design and Technology (D&T) skill of making.
In this lesson, the children will follow their designs to construct their Gothic-themed models. They will measure and cut materials carefully, using suitable tools and techniques to ensure accuracy. Pupils will strengthen and reinforce their structures and incorporate electrical or mechanical systems to create light, movement, or sound effects. They will apply finishing techniques to enhance appearance, ensuring their final model is both functional and visually striking.

National Curriculum objectives
Design & Technology: Year 6
Pupils should be taught to:
select from and use a wider range of tools and equipment to perform practical tasks (e.g. cutting, shaping, joining and finishing), accurately
select from and use a wider range of materials and components, including construction materials and textiles, according to their functional properties and aesthetic qualities
apply their understanding of how to strengthen, stiffen and reinforce more complex structures
understand and use mechanical systems in their products (for example, gears, pulleys, cams, levers and linkages)...
